Output 57934652ae9a71f9c349660c445c21285d098168b089e599992047435a7b1590:5

value
2081767907
script pubkey
OP_0 OP_PUSHBYTES_20 8ace21a428ff9ac7167d100f066c19bc46afef73
address
ltc1q3t8zrfpgl7dvw9nazq8svmqeh3r2lmmn6zdzw0
transaction
57934652ae9a71f9c349660c445c21285d098168b089e599992047435a7b1590
spent
true